Combination therapy significantly boosts survival for certain liver cancer patients

Liver cancer treated with chemoembolization
During TACE, doctors inject tiny beads filled with chemotherapy directly into the blood vessels that supply the tumor. These beads release medicine to attack the cancer cells while also blocking the blood flow to the tumor. Thermal ablation uses high-energy radio waves to create heat at the tip of the catheter to further destroy tumor cells. – Image credit Dr. Harsh Shah

CANCER DIGEST – Aug. 8, 2026 – Adding heat to destroy tumor tissue after direct doses of chemotherapy in liver cancer that cannot be treated with surgery significantly increased overall survival in selected patients, clinical trial results show.


The clinical trial led by Ning Lyu, MD of Sun Yat-sen University Cancer Center in  Guangzhou China, patients with liver cancers that could not be removed by surgery were treated with transarterial chemoembolization with and without added thermal ablation. The results were published online July 30, 2026 ahead of print in the journal JAMA Oncology.


Transarterial chemoembolization is a treatment that directly injects chemotherapy into tumors to kill tumor tissue. Thermal ablation is using radio waves to heat the tumor tissue to further destroy tumor cells.


In the trial, researchers randomly assigned 241 patients with liver cancers to be treated with the combination chemotherapy and thermal ablation (121),or were treated with the direct injection chemotherapy alone (120). Among the clinical outcomes the researchers aimed to improve was progression-free survival, meaning the time the cancer stops growing, and overall survival.


At the point when data collection was stopped more than 10 years after the first patient was treated, the results showed that those treated with the combination therapy had progression-free survival average of 17.7 months compared to 7.3 months for the chemotherapy alone group.


Overall survival in the combination therapy group was 86.6 months compared to 35.1 months in the chemotherapy alone group.


The results also showed that patient selection was essential to reaching the improved outcomes. After the chemoembolization the number and size of remaining tumors were evaluated. Only patients with low to moderate size and number of tumors received the thermal ablation.


In a JAMA commentary, it was pointed out that this trial started in 2015 and while it compared the combination therapy to the standard therapy at the time, it could not be compared to approaches using immunotherapy that have shown improvements in progression-free survival, but have had mixed results in terms of overall survival.


The researchers concluded that in this trial, the difference in progression-free survival and overall survival in these two groups of patients marks a significant improvement in outcomes with combined chemoembolization and thermal ablation approach for selected patients.
